My story

I am making the difficult decision to rehome my beloved adult cat since having a baby. I have not been able to properly provide her the love and care that she deserves and would love to see her united with someone who is looking for a cuddly companion in a single-pet home. I rescued Muse from a shelter in Thurston County when she was about one year old in 2019. There was not a lot of information given other than they found her wandering.I got her when I was living alone in an apartment and she was happiest when it was just me and her. When I moved in with my now husband, she did take a while to warm up but now she will happily sit on his lap. When I was pregnant, Muse did not leave my side. After having the baby for a year and a half, her needs have become second. Both my husband and I work full time and all of our energy now goes towards our daughter and Muse often gets left behind. I am hoping to find someone who will love her and keep her company in her later years.

If you have any questions or would like to adopt Muse, please reach out to the adoption group directly. PetSmart Charities does not facilitate the adoption process. Thank you.
